Steps in Making Inferences:

STEP 1: Figure out the main idea, key details, and organizational
pattern.

STEP 2: Notice the details –especially those that are unusual or stand
out.

STEP 3: Look for unfamiliar words.

STEP 4: Add up the facts.

STEP 6: Consider the author’s purpose.
